Abstract
1,241,360. Electric couplings &c. SIEMENS A.G. 16 Oct., 1969 [28 Feb.; 1969], No. 50948/69. Heading H2E. One or more tapes of an olefinic copolymer of at least two olefins are wound on the end of a polyolefin insulated cable, and are then crosslinked or vulcanized to form an integral body chemically bonded to the polyolefin insulation and able to withstand the rated voltage of the cable during continuous operation. Two single conductor cables 1, with either crosslinked, or high or low pressure. polyethylene insulation 3, and conductor smoothing layer 4, conductive varnish layer 5, textile tape 6, screening 7, and sheathing 8 are joined by soldering to a jointing sleeve 10. Weakly conducting tapes 11 of ethylene-propylene-terpolymer are wound on sleeve 10 and cover layer 4 on each cable. Tapes of ethylene-propylene-terpolymer are wound over tapes 11 and insulations 3 to form a sleeve, and all the copolymer is crosslinked or vulcanized by heat, and possibly also pressure so that an integral body chemically bonded to the insulations 3 is formed. To effect dross.linking a peroxide may be employed, or must be employed for an ethylene-propylene elastomer, and for vulcanizing, a mixture of sulphur and an organic accelerator, for example mercaptobenzthiazole or tetrainethylthiuram disulphide. A layer of varnish, united with varnish 5 of the cables is applied, and a conductive tape 13, copper strip 14, and plastics tape 15. An epoxy resin body 16 is cast around the joint, or (Fig. 2, not shown) a polyvinyl chloride tube (17) is shrunk on to it; The copolymer may be ethylene-olefin copolymer, or an ethylene propylene elastomei, or may contain as a third component a polyunsaturated hydrocarbon, e.g. a diene.
